Q Li is a scholar working on Molecular Biology, Cardiology and Cardiovascular Medicine and Surgery. According to data from OpenAlex, Q Li has authored 6 papers receiving a total of 805 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Molecular Biology, 3 papers in Cardiology and Cardiovascular Medicine and 1 paper in Surgery. Recurrent topics in Q Li’s work include Cardiac Fibrosis and Remodeling (2 papers), Coagulation, Bradykinin, Polyphosphates, and Angioedema (1 paper) and Cardiovascular, Neuropeptides, and Oxidative Stress Research (1 paper). Q Li is often cited by papers focused on Cardiac Fibrosis and Remodeling (2 papers), Coagulation, Bradykinin, Polyphosphates, and Angioedema (1 paper) and Cardiovascular, Neuropeptides, and Oxidative Stress Research (1 paper). Q Li collaborates with scholars based in China, United States and Canada. Q Li's co-authors include Piero Anversa, Annarosa Leri, Jan Kajstura, Xiaohui Wang, Renato Baserga, Xiaodong Wang, Ashwani Malhotra, Pier Paolo Claudio, Shanshan Wang and Krzysztof Reiss and has published in prestigious journals such as Journal of Clinical Investigation, Clinical and Experimental Pharmacology and Physiology and International Journal of Clinical Practice.
